In These Parts

In these parts,
Heavy dews cover fields and lawns;
It's very hot and humid in summer;
There are no breathtaking views,
No snow-covered mountains, no waterfalls;
And the weather changes rather rapidly.

In these parts,
Surrounded by trees, corn, and beans,
The canopy covers me from above.
A paved road separates me from the beans,
And sometimes I'm being held captive, it seems.

In these parts,
Black birds, dears, occasional sightings of doves;
Heavy commerce fuels the passage of trains.
And dark clouds provide plenty of rain.

In these parts,
Silence and bird songs are tonics to keep us sane.
Touches of God help control heartaches and pain,
And alertness is demanded by highways with 2 lanes.

In these parts,
Rural nights of captivating darkness,
Sirens, horns, and roaring traffic
have been arrested by the quietness.

Perhaps it's different where you reside,
And perhaps you like it best where you live.
But that's the way it is in these parts.
